The news is fueling the right reactions and controversies of the associations that fight against homophobic and discriminatory behavior. The news, in its violence, should not be silenced since it speaks of a boy targeted by a group of violent and ignorant people.
They were even in seven against one: all young. They blocked him in the car, attacking him and going as far as to put out two cigarette butts on his arm while others had him immobilized.
All because he's gay. It happened in Penniniello district the other evening. The person who was the victim of the violence is 34 years old, and he said he stopped in Seven-Termini Street.
He was chatting with a friend. It was 23pm when he was attacked.
The friend managed to escape, the young man was reportedly locked in the car, beaten and two cigarette butts were allegedly put out on him.
'I'm not reticent, but I'm afraid. Afraid that something worse could happen to me'
The 34-year-old explained that he went to the police to report the incident but then stopped when he was asked to try to identify his attackers. ”I am not reticent, but I am afraid.
Fear that something worse could happen to me” he confessed to those who took his testimony. When the gang surrounded the car and forced the girl out (who managed to escape), attention turned to the thirty-four-year-old.
the firm condemnation of Pride Vesuvio Rainbow
The echoes of the violence have reached the representatives of the Arcobaleno associations of the Vesuvian city.
Pride Vesuvio Rainbow has organized a public initiative in the area where the attack took place: ”We cannot remain silent – the referents explain Pride Vesevio Rainbow – and for this reason we are calling associations, free citizens for Thursday 24 June at 19.30:XNUMX pm, in via Settetermini, to express closeness and solidarity to the victims, to condemn this unacceptable violence. We cannot and must not remain silent, we will never accept this climate of terror and violence”.
The solidarity of the mayor of Torre Annunziata
The mayor of Torre Annunziata, Vincenzo Ascione, is on the same wavelength: ”To the young victim of this deplorable incident, I ask you to have the courage to come forward.
He will find all the psychological and social support from the Municipality and social services". The mayor speaks of a ”an extremely inclusive city, as demonstrated by the various initiatives carried out with Arcigay. It is unfortunate that the victim preferred to tell the newspapers about this unpleasant episode rather than contact the competent authorities.
But I am sure that if he does come forward, he will appreciate the support of a very inclusive community that unfortunately has to deal with the intolerance of small groups."
